1. What are the exact dimensions for a Facebook Event cover?
While the ideal size is 1920 x 1005 pixels, the true secret isn't the pixels—it's the aspect ratio of 1.91:1. Facebook's interface is fluid, and our tool ensures your image adheres to this ratio perfectly, so it scales correctly everywhere, from a wide desktop monitor to a narrow mobile screen.
2. Why is my cover perfectly centered on desktop but butchered on mobile?
This is the most common pain point. Facebook's mobile interface applies a much tighter, vertical crop. A generic image resizer won't show you this. Our tool's "safe zone" overlay is your secret weapon; it visually defines the core area that remains visible on all devices, so you can position critical elements like speaker faces or event dates securely within these bounds.

5. What exactly is the "safe zone" and why is it non-negotiable?
Think of the safe zone as the "essential information" box within your larger image. It's the central ⅔ of the canvas that is guaranteed to be visible on mobile. I always advise clients to place their event's value proposition—the headline, date, and key visual—squarely within this zone. Everything outside of it is bonus scenery for the desktop view.

8. I followed the steps, but my cover is still blurry. What gives?
If you've started with a high-res image and it's still soft, the issue is often Facebook's own compression. After uploading, always click to view the full-size image on the event page. Facebook applies heavy compression by default. If it's still unacceptable, try saving your image as a PNG before uploading, as it sometimes handles sharp text and lines better than JPG.
